Nestled in the heart of Ottumwa, Iowa, Rock Bluff Park is a nature lover’s paradise, offering breathtaking views, diverse wildlife, and outdoor adventures for tourists seeking a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. This scenic nature preserve is perfect for fishing, hiking, and enjoying the great outdoors.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are traveling by car within the Historic Hills Scenic Byway, head towards Ottumwa, Iowa. From the scenic byway, take the exit for US-63 S toward Ottumwa. Continue on US-63 S for about 10 miles. As you approach Ottumwa, take the exit for IA-149 S toward Eldon. After approximately 2 miles, turn right onto Rock Bluff Rd. Continue straight for about 1 mile, and you will find Rock Bluff Park on your left. Remember to check for parking availability upon arrival.
